Here are a few of the daily responsibilities of an LPN:
Assist residents with Activities of Daily Living (ADL), family/social activities and actively promote independent life-style of residents.
Responsible for identification of resident medical and behavioral changes and the development and monitoring of care plans and re-assessment of each resident.
Provide daily report to the Director of Health Services concerning community conditions, personnel performance, resident conditions, and needs for nursing supplies.
Provide nursing care according to physician's orders and in conformance with recognized nursing practice, established standards, and administrative policies.
Ensure preventative, therapeutic and rehabilitative services to residents and assists in the coordination of nursing care with care rendered by other disciplines.
